ODA aid disbursements for STD control including HIV/AIDS, DAC donors in Kenya
Kenya: ODA aid disbursements for STD control including HIV/AIDS, DAC donors was 418.74 million current US$ in 2011. ◆ Volatile
ODA aid disbursements for STD control including HIV/AIDS, DAC donors in Kenya, 2002–2011
Source: Development Assistance Committee of the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development. Measured in current US$.
Analysis
Kenya recorded 418.74 million current US$ for oda aid disbursements for std control including hiv/aids, dac donors in 2011. That is the highest value across all 10 years on record.
The figure is up 22.0% on the previous year and up 2,332.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, oda aid disbursements for std control including hiv/aids, dac donors in Kenya peaked at 418.74 million current US$ in 2011 and was at its lowest, 17.22 million current US$, in 2002.
That places Kenya 2nd out of 49 countries with data for 2011, putting it in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
ODA aid disbursements for STD control including HIV/AIDS, DAC donors in Kenya, year by year
| Year | current US$ |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2002 | 17.22 million current US$ | — |
| 2003 | 54.19 million current US$ | +214.7% |
| 2004 | 75.42 million current US$ | +39.2% |
| 2005 | 82.77 million current US$ | +9.7% |
| 2006 | 155.07 million current US$ | +87.3% |
| 2007 | 196.04 million current US$ | +26.4% |
| 2008 | 288.80 million current US$ | +47.3% |
| 2009 | 357.74 million current US$ | +23.9% |
| 2010 | 343.12 million current US$ | -4.1% |
| 2011 | 418.74 million current US$ | +22.0% |

About this data
All activities related to sexually transmitted diseases and HIV/AIDS control e.g. information, education and communication; testing; prevention; treatment, care.
